Karan Tacker is enjoying the success of his show Ek Hazaaron Mein Meri Behna Hain on Star Plus but this festive season he is looking forward to loads of masti in his show, in specials on the channels and also his celebrity appearances.
A festive season is a great bonus for celebrities. What are you doing this Navratri?
I am going to three pandals this Navratri in Surat, Mumbai and Guwahati. I was surprised+ to hear that in Guwahati garba and dandiya are celebrated with vigour. But I am looking forward to some cool fun. I will enjoy the beauty and get a break too. Of course, I have heard it isn't very safe there, so let's see.
How do you celebrate Navratri at home?
I am a Punjabi, so as a kid we celebrated Navratras. Feeding nine young girls among other celebrations, was a norm. Now, I hardly get time to do anything. Work takes up all my time.
Buzz is that you are quitting your show?
Yes I have heard that too. But it isn't true unless they want to replace me. I am happy with the show and the makers. These are just rumours, I am on the show as of now.
You shot for a Diwali special for the channel. Was it fun?
Yes, I enjoy these specials a lot. They give me a good break as we get to sing and dance and break the monotony of the usual shoot. I enjoy dressing up. And mostly I have so much fun that I don't feel like going back to the serial.
How do you look back on your career?
It has been a good run. I am enjoying and discovering myself. I am a natural actor and don't push myself to do anything I don't like. I take each scene as normally as I can and deliver as I don't like theatrics.
